Handover note — Marlowe to Ostrey, re: Perchline public API pagination. The cursor-based pagination is merged but the legacy offset params still work behind a flag; please review the deprecation warnings carefully before approving. Edge case: empty pages mid-cursor when records are deleted concurrently — test covers it. The staging credentials vault re-locked after my rotation, so to run the integration suite you'll need the recovery passphrase below.

vault phrase of bahop-yahaf = novael-ralir-gilox-praeth

## Changelog — Togglewright 4.2 (Changed Defaults)

Welcome, new folks: this release changes several rollout defaults, so please read carefully. Gradual rollouts now start at 1% instead of 5%, and the evaluation cache refresh interval was shortened to reduce stale-flag windows. Kill-switch propagation is now synchronous by default, which adds slight latency but prevents split-brain states we saw last quarter. The full set of new default configuration values follows below.

service settings:
[casax]
port = 6379
team = rusir
host = casax.zemvarhq.corp
region = outer-4
access_code = ac_9808ce
timeout_ms = 1500

## Break-glass access — Cratewise pick-list optimizer

Reviewers occasionally need emergency read access to the Cratewise production config to verify optimizer behavior against live routing data. Break-glass use must be logged in the review thread and expires after four hours. The emergency console requires the reviewer recovery passphrase, recorded below for authorized use:

strongbox words: gilok-druion-briath-wendor-briion-prawyn-fenion-oliir-casdor-holius-briius-gilath-gilael-pelys

**Ticket: Kiosk watchdog keeps flapping the DB pool**

Flagging for the weekly sync: the Ordio kiosk watchdog restarts the app whenever three pings fail, but since Tuesday it's been tripping every ~40 minutes at the Brellton site. Looks like the health check uses a separate short-timeout connection that dies under load, so the watchdog kills a perfectly healthy app. Short-term fix is bumping the timeout; longer-term we should share the main pool. To reproduce, point a test client at the staging store using the connection string below.

warehouse DSN: mssql://rusdor_svc:0FSWCn9@db-951a.paliqforge.local:5432/ulawyn